Fermi Grounds. When is it going to be built? by Scarlet_Jackalope in amarillo

[–]FrostedMoose19 3 points4 points  (0 children)

Construction jobs for up to 9000 over the next 15 years, and several thousand permanent jobs at the power plant and AI facility, plus no telling what other industry will relocate here for a chance to buy power behind the meter at wholesale prices.

Add to that 1500 jobs at Producer Owned Beef, being built just a few miles to the southwest, and up to 1000 jobs when Bell Flight begins construction of the MV75 in 2028. Bell will be building thousands of these advanced aircraft here over three decades and shipping them all over the world.

Amarillo's economy is incredibly well diversified. We have opportunities for all trades, factory works, engineers and scientists of various types, management. Amarillo is in really good shape right now. I wouldn't trade our economy for any other midsize city in the U.S., particularly with the developments at Bell, Fermi, Pantex, and agriculture.

All of these folks eat at restaurants, shop at stores, buy cars, live in neighborhoods, and pay taxes. So look for better shopping, more eateries, new schools, and new neighborhoods. Lots of positive things right now in Amarillo.
